Informational
What is supply chain resilience and why does it matter?

Supply chain resilience is the ability to anticipate, absorb, and recover from disruptions. It matters because unplanned shocks, supplier failures, demand spikes, logistics breakdowns, directly hit revenue and service levels.

Procedural
How do I assess the resilience of my supply chain?

Work through a structured self-assessment covering key resilience dimensions, flexibility, redundancy, visibility, and recovery. Score each area honestly and the gaps become immediately visible.

Strategic
What are the key dimensions of supply chain resilience?

Flexibility, redundancy, visibility, supplier health, agility, and recovery capability. Strong resilience requires all dimensions, weakness in one can compromise the others during a real disruption.

Comparison
How does a self-assessment compare to a full resilience audit?

A self-assessment is faster, cheaper, and gives you an honest internal baseline immediately. A formal audit adds independent validation, but the self-assessment is the right first step for most teams.

Decision
How do I prioritise resilience improvements after an assessment?

Focus first on the dimensions that scored lowest and carry the highest business impact. The assessment output maps directly to these priorities, start there, not with the easiest fixes.

Implementation
How often should a supply chain resilience assessment be run?

At minimum annually, and after any major disruption or structural change. Quarterly reviews help teams track whether improvement actions are actually moving the needle on resilience scores.
